Product Description

Size: 100µL / 1mL
Rabbit Recombinant Monoclonal ABI2 antibody. Suitable for IHC-P, ICC/IF and reacts with Human samples. Cited in 2 publications.
Key facts
Host species:Rabbit,
Clonality:Monoclonal,
Clone number:EPR3906,
Isotype:IgG,
Carrier free:No,
Reacts with:Human,
Applications:ICC/IF, IHC-PSee reactivity dataSee the reactivity data table below for information on validated species and application combinations.,
Immunogen:The exact immunogen used to generate this antibody is proprietary information.

What are the advantages of a recombinant monoclonal antibody?
This product is a recombinant monoclonal antibody, which offers several advantages including:
- High batch-to-batch consistency and reproducibility
- Improved sensitivity and specificity
- Long-term security of supply
- Animal-free batch production

Properties and Storage Information:
Form-Liquid, Purity-Tissue culture supernatant, Storage buffer-pH: 7.2 - 7.4Preservative: 0.05% Sodium azideConstituents: 50% Tissue culture supernatant, 40% Glycerol (glycerin, glycerine), 9.85% Tris glycine, 0.1% BSA, Shipped at conditions-Blue Ice, Appropriate short-term storage conditions-+4°C, Appropriate long-term storage conditions--20°C, Storage information-Stable for 12 months at -20°C

ABI2 also known as Abl-Interactor 2 is a protein encoded by the ABI2 gene. It has a molecular mass of approximately 53 kDa. ABI2 functions as a regulator of actin cytoskeleton dynamics and participates in processes involving cell motility and morphology. This protein is mainly expressed in neuronal tissues and is found in the cytoplasm suggesting its involvement in intracellular signaling pathways where actin rearrangement is important.
Biological function summary
ABI2 impacts cellular functions by interacting with the WAVE (WASP-family verprolin-homologous) complex. This interaction facilitates the regulation of actin polymerization important for processes such as cell migration and synaptic plasticity. ABI2 through the WAVE complex plays a role in the formation of lamellipodia cellular protrusions important for movement. This regulation ensures that cells respond effectively to external stimuli by reorganizing their cytoskeleton.
Pathways
The protein contributes significantly to the regulation of the Rac1 signaling pathway important for cytoskeletal remodeling. ABI2 works closely with proteins such as NCK proteins and phosphoinositides that are part of this pathway. Furthermore ABI2 interacts with the PAK family of kinases influencing downstream signaling that controls cell cycle progression and survival. ABI2’s role in these pathways highlights its importance in maintaining cellular architecture and dynamics.
ABI2 is implicated in neurological conditions particularly Alzheimer's disease and schizophrenia. Its interaction with other proteins like APP (amyloid precursor protein) suggests a role in synaptic dysfunction seen in these disorders. ABI2’s involvement in actin dynamics connects it to synaptic defects that may contribute to cognitive impairments in Alzheimer's disease. Understanding ABI2’s function and interactions offers insights into therapeutic targets for these neurological conditions.
